Finally, the title of the Wolverine\/Ghost Rider story starts to make sense. Acts of Vengeance was a crossover where villains took on heroes they didn&#8217;t normally fight in an effort to disorient and defeat them. It&#8217;s finally made clear here that, although Deathwatch&#8217;s goons were being used, Deathwatch wasn&#8217;t the one giving the orders. That was a neat twist to the story &#8211; especially after so many issues seeming to imply that Deathwatch was in charge. The elements of the Shanna story all seem to be coming together nicely &#8211; and the same goes for Daredevil&#8217;s. The events of the Black Widow story take place after events in <em>Quasar <\/em>#19-24. This story goes to show how, clearly, the Presence is completely out of his mind. He sends Starlight to make Darkstar one of his female concubines &#8211; even though she&#8217;s his daughter!
